Home
last modified time | relevance | path

Searched refs:_mm256_slli_epi16 (Results 1 – 13 of 13) sorted by relevance

/external/libaom/libaom/av1/common/x86/
Dcfl_avx2.c137 row_lo = _mm256_slli_epi16(row_lo, 3); in cfl_luma_subsampling_444_lbd_avx2()
139 row_hi = _mm256_slli_epi16(row_hi, 3); in cfl_luma_subsampling_444_lbd_avx2()
215 hsum = _mm256_slli_epi16(hsum, 2); in cfl_luma_subsampling_422_hbd_avx2()
235 _mm256_storeu_si256(row, _mm256_slli_epi16(top, 3)); in cfl_luma_subsampling_444_hbd_avx2()
236 _mm256_storeu_si256(row + 1, _mm256_slli_epi16(top_1, 3)); in cfl_luma_subsampling_444_hbd_avx2()
259 const __m256i alpha_q12 = _mm256_slli_epi16(_mm256_abs_epi16(alpha_sign), 9); in cfl_predict_lbd_avx2()
309 return _mm256_xor_si256(_mm256_slli_epi16(neg_one, bd), neg_one); in highbd_max_epi16()
323 const __m256i alpha_q12 = _mm256_slli_epi16(_mm256_abs_epi16(alpha_sign), 9); in cfl_predict_hbd_avx2()
Dwiener_convolve_avx2.c142 data_0 = _mm256_slli_epi16(data_0, FILTER_BITS - conv_params->round_0); in av1_wiener_convolve_add_src_avx2()
Djnt_convolve_avx2.c94 res = _mm256_slli_epi16(res, bits); in av1_dist_wtd_convolve_x_avx2()
149 res = _mm256_slli_epi16(res, bits); in av1_dist_wtd_convolve_x_avx2()
Dhighbd_inv_txfm_avx2.c37 const __m256i max = _mm256_sub_epi16(_mm256_slli_epi16(one, bd), one); in highbd_clamp_epi16_avx2()
/external/libvpx/libvpx/vpx_dsp/x86/
Dfwd_dct32x32_impl_avx2.h139 step1a[0] = _mm256_slli_epi16(step1a[0], 2); in FDCT32x32_2D_AVX2()
140 step1a[1] = _mm256_slli_epi16(step1a[1], 2); in FDCT32x32_2D_AVX2()
141 step1a[2] = _mm256_slli_epi16(step1a[2], 2); in FDCT32x32_2D_AVX2()
142 step1a[3] = _mm256_slli_epi16(step1a[3], 2); in FDCT32x32_2D_AVX2()
143 step1b[-3] = _mm256_slli_epi16(step1b[-3], 2); in FDCT32x32_2D_AVX2()
144 step1b[-2] = _mm256_slli_epi16(step1b[-2], 2); in FDCT32x32_2D_AVX2()
145 step1b[-1] = _mm256_slli_epi16(step1b[-1], 2); in FDCT32x32_2D_AVX2()
146 step1b[-0] = _mm256_slli_epi16(step1b[-0], 2); in FDCT32x32_2D_AVX2()
175 step1a[0] = _mm256_slli_epi16(step1a[0], 2); in FDCT32x32_2D_AVX2()
176 step1a[1] = _mm256_slli_epi16(step1a[1], 2); in FDCT32x32_2D_AVX2()
[all …]
/external/libaom/libaom/av1/encoder/x86/
Dav1_quantize_avx2.c62 qp[1] = _mm256_slli_epi16(qp[1], log_scale); in init_qp()
381 qh = _mm256_slli_epi16(qh, 2); in quantize_64x64()
384 const __m256i dqh = _mm256_slli_epi16(_mm256_mulhi_epi16(q, qp[2]), 14); in quantize_64x64()
Dpickrst_avx2.c527 const __m256i u0 = _mm256_slli_epi16(d0, SGRPROJ_RST_BITS); in av1_lowbd_pixel_proj_error_avx2()
888 const __m256i u0 = _mm256_slli_epi16(d0, SGRPROJ_RST_BITS); in av1_highbd_pixel_proj_error_avx2()
Dav1_fwd_txfm2d_avx2.c1429 output[i] = _mm256_slli_epi16(input[i], 2); in fidentity16x32_avx2()
/external/libaom/libaom/aom_dsp/x86/
Dintrapred_avx2.c1090 _mm256_slli_epi16(_mm256_set1_epi16(x), upsample_above), in highbd_dr_prediction_z1_4xN_internal_avx2()
1101 a32 = _mm256_slli_epi16(a0, 5); // a[x] * 32 in highbd_dr_prediction_z1_4xN_internal_avx2()
1341 _mm256_slli_epi16(_mm256_set1_epi16(x), upsample_above), c3f), in highbd_dr_prediction_z1_8xN_internal_avx2()
1354 a32 = _mm256_slli_epi16(a0, 5); // a[x] * 32 in highbd_dr_prediction_z1_8xN_internal_avx2()
1504 a32 = _mm256_slli_epi16(a0, 5); // a[x] * 32 in highbd_dr_prediction_z1_16xN_internal_avx2()
1682 a32 = _mm256_slli_epi16(a0, 5); // a[x] * 32 in highbd_dr_prediction_z1_32xN_internal_avx2()
1877 a32 = _mm256_slli_epi16(a0, 5); // a[x] * 32 in highbd_dr_prediction_z1_64xN_avx2()
2194 a32 = _mm256_slli_epi16(a0_x, 5); // a[x] * 32 in highbd_dr_prediction_z2_Nx4_avx2()
2488 a32 = _mm256_slli_epi16(a0_x, 5); // a[x] * 32 in highbd_dr_prediction_z2_Nx8_avx2()
2787 r6 = _mm256_slli_epi16(_mm256_add_epi16(c0123, j256), 6); in highbd_dr_prediction_z2_HxW_avx2()
[all …]
Dtxfm_common_avx2.h244 in[i] = _mm256_slli_epi16(in[i], bit); in round_shift_16bit_w16_avx2()
/external/libaom/libaom/aom_dsp/simd/
Dv256_intrinsics_x86.h683 _mm256_slli_epi16(a, c))
689 #define v256_shl_n_16(a, c) _mm256_slli_epi16(a, c)
/external/clang/test/CodeGen/
Davx2-builtins.c973 return _mm256_slli_epi16(a, 3); in test_mm256_slli_epi16()
/external/clang/lib/Headers/
Davx2intrin.h596 _mm256_slli_epi16(__m256i __a, int __count) in _mm256_slli_epi16() function